    Automated claims processing is the application of advanced technologies, including Artificial Intelligence (AI) and Optical Character Recognition (OCR), to manage and expedite the entire lifecycle of an insurance claim, from initial submission to final settlement.

    Why is automated claims processing becoming essential in banking and insurance?

    The banking and insurance sectors are undergoing significant digital transformation, driven by increasing customer expectations and competitive pressures. Legacy systems often lead to slow, manual processes, resulting in lengthy claim cycle times and high operational costs. For instance, the industry-wide average claim cycle time can be as high as 40.7 to 44 days, contributing to customer dissatisfaction.

    Automated claims processing addresses these challenges directly. It replaces fragmented, human-intensive workflows with intelligent, rules-driven automation. This shift is no longer a luxury but a strategic imperative for carriers aiming to reduce processing time and improve overall service quality.

    How does AI enhance insurance claims automation?

    Artificial Intelligence (AI) serves as the brain behind automated claims processing, enabling systems to perform complex tasks that mimic human intelligence but at a much faster rate. AI algorithms analyze vast amounts of data, learn from patterns, and make informed decisions, significantly enhancing efficiency and accuracy.

    Key AI functionalities include predictive analytics for risk assessment, fraud detection, and automated decision-making. By leveraging AI, insurance companies can identify suspicious claims early, categorize claims accurately, and even determine settlement amounts for straightforward cases. This leads to a reduction in manual review queues and faster payouts.

    What role does OCR play in intelligent document scanning for damage files?

    Optical Character Recognition (OCR) is a foundational technology for automating damage file processing. It converts various document types—such as scanned images of claim forms, medical records, police reports, and third-party documentation—into machine-readable data.

    Without OCR, the information contained in these unstructured documents would require manual data entry, which is time-consuming and prone to errors. With intelligent OCR, data can be extracted accurately and quickly, feeding directly into AI-powered systems for analysis and processing. This eliminates manual data entry, enabling end-to-end automation of the claims intake process.

    What are the measurable benefits of automating claims processing with AI and OCR?

    The implementation of AI and OCR in claims processing yields substantial and measurable benefits for banking and insurance entities. These advantages span efficiency gains, cost reductions, and improved customer experience.

    Concrete Benefits:

    • Processing Speed: Companies adopting AI automation can process claims up to 75% faster. Claims that typically took 30 days can now be completed in as little as 7.5 days.
    • Cost Savings: Operational costs per claim can be reduced by 30% to 40%. This saving comes from minimized manual labor, reduced errors, and optimized resource allocation.
    • Straight-Through Processing (STP): AI and OCR enable Straight-Through Processing for 70% to 90% of typical personal lines policies. This means a significant portion of claims can be handled from start to finish without human intervention.
    • Customer Satisfaction: With faster processing and fewer errors, customer satisfaction significantly improves. Studies show that 52% of policyholders with a poor digital claims experience are likely to switch providers, while only 4% of those with an excellent experience would consider leaving.

    How can banking and insurance companies implement AI for claims processing?

    Implementing AI for claims processing involves several strategic steps to ensure a successful transition and maximize benefits. It requires a clear roadmap and a focus on integration and data quality.

    Here are key steps for implementation:

    1. Assess Current Processes: Identify bottlenecks and manual touchpoints in existing claims workflows. Understand the types of documents involved and the data points critical for processing.
    2. Define Clear Objectives: Determine specific goals, such as reducing processing time by a certain percentage or lowering costs per claim. This guides technology selection and deployment.
    3. Choose the Right Technology Stack: Select AI and OCR solutions that are robust, scalable, and capable of integrating with existing core systems. Consider vendors with expertise in financial services.
    4. Data Preparation and Training: Cleanse and prepare historical claims data to train AI models effectively. The quality of training data directly impacts the accuracy and performance of the AI.
    5. Phased Implementation: Start with a pilot program for a specific type of claim or a subset of operations. This allows for testing, refinement, and demonstrating initial ROI before a full-scale rollout.
    6. Integration with Core Systems: Ensure seamless integration of the AI and OCR solutions with existing policy administration, CRM, and payment systems to create a unified workflow.
    7. Continuous Monitoring and Optimization: Regularly monitor the performance of AI models and claims processing metrics. Use feedback loops to retrain models and optimize workflows for continuous improvement.

    What are the challenges in adopting AI for claims processing?

    While the benefits are clear, adopting AI and OCR for claims processing comes with its own set of challenges. These include data privacy concerns, the need for high-quality data, and the complexity of integrating new systems with legacy infrastructure.

    One significant hurdle is ensuring compliance with stringent regulatory requirements in the banking and insurance sectors, especially regarding data handling and automated decision-making. Furthermore, the initial investment in technology and training can be substantial, requiring a clear business case and executive buy-in. It is crucial to address these challenges proactively through careful planning and expert partnership.

    Who this is NOT for

    This technology is not ideal for very small, niche insurance providers with extremely low claim volumes or those unwilling to invest in digital transformation. It is also not suitable for organizations with highly specialized, non-standardized claim types that require extensive human judgment beyond current AI capabilities, or those lacking the clean, structured data necessary for effective AI training.
